Around 1,450 police personnel will be deployed across the city to ensure peaceful New Year Eve celebrations on Tueday. According to a police official, comprehensive security arrangements have been made, with a significant deployment of officers, including 13 DSPs, 16 SHOs and 19 Inspectors, who will be on the ground maintaining law and order.

Senior officers will oversee and monitor the security arrangements throughout the evening.

Women squad

A dedicated women’s squad has been formed to assist women. Eight PCR Vehicles with lady staff will be deployed at different places to assist those needing a safe ride home.

Besides, 44 internal nakas and 18 outer border nakas will be set up. Six ambulances, five fire tenders and three QRTs will be deployed at different places in the city to curb hooliganism. Special checkpoints will also be established to check drunken driving. Patrolling by PCR vehicles will be intensified in the city, especially around the places holding New Year Eve functions. The police personnel will also patrol parking lots to prevent public drinking, particularly in cars. They will also carry out special anti-sabotage check at places witnessing huge footfall.

Vehicular movement on certain road stretches will be restricted. These include internal roads of Sectors 7, 8, 9, 10 and 11. Only the residents of these Sectors will be allowed to enter.

Heavy police deployment will be made at the Plaza, Sector 17; Elante Mall, Industrial Area Phase-I; near Aroma Hotel, Sector 22, besides clubs and restaurants in Sectors 7, 8, 9, 26, 35, 43, 22.

Elaborate traffic arrangements will also be made by the police. Ahead of the New Year celebrations, five gazetted officers have been assigned responsibility for security, with around 300 police personnel will be deployed across Panchkula.
